Governor Sandoval’s Workforce
Initiative – Silver State Works
Effective July 1, 2011, DETR is implementing a new “umbrella”
employment and training initiative, in collaboration with
workforce investment system partners, to include:




Local Workforce Investment Boards
Department of Health and Human Services
Department of Corrections
Economic Development
Through a seamless service delivery strategy, Silver State
Works seeks to expedite the return to work of specific
populations of job seekers in targeted sectors and provide
employers with suitable and skilled workers.

Silver State Works
•
•
•
DETR is re-directing $4.6 million of existing client service
funds for each year of the biennium and will administer the
initiative with existing staff resources
In DHHS’s budget request, Governor Sandoval has
designated $6 million in FY12 and $4 million in FY13 in
new General Funds for this initiative to support the Welfare
Division’s efforts to get TANF and TANF-At Risk back to
work
Collective goal with all partner programs is to place up to
10,000 workers in these programs by the end of FY13

Silver State Works
Silver State Works is an integrated, employer-focused
initiative which targets the following populations:
•
•
•
•
•
•
Temporary Assistance for Needy Families (TANF) OR
candidates “at-risk” of coming on TANF
Persons with Disabilities
Veterans
Ex-Offenders as they re-enter mainstream society
Unemployment Insurance Recipients
Older Youth – Age 19-21 who are eligible for services as
defined in the Workforce Investment Act of 1998
5
The Nevada Department of Employment, Training and Rehabilitation is a proactive workforce & rehabilitation agency
Silver State Works
Candidates will be assessed at 3 levels of
self-sufficiency:
• Tier 1 – Multiple or complex barriers
• Tier 2 – Transferable skills; minor
barriers
• Tier 3 – Self-Sufficiency
Tier 3 candidates will receive specific
program incentives to encourage an
employer to hire

Silver State Works Incentive Programs
Employer Based Training – allows laid off workers, who qualify for UI
benefits, to simultaneously receive on-site training and regular UI
benefits.








Available to other targeted populations
Provides a $200 training allowance every 2 weeks; $600 maximum
Participation for UI claimants is voluntary, but encouraged
Participants are required to work 24 hours/week up to 6 weeks while continuing a
regular work search
Participants may pursue a training opportunity already offered by an employer OR
find an interested employer on their own
Employers are encouraged to hire trainees as a condition of participation in Silver
State Works
Orientations will be held on a regularly scheduled basis at Nevada JobConnect (NJC)
offices statewide
Information received during the orientation will include:
•
•
How to improve chances of transforming training into permanent work status
How to maximize the training opportunity
 NJC offices will develop training sites and complete all forms

Silver State Works Incentive Programs
Employer Incentive Job Program – Although the focus of Silver State
Works is high growth and/or high demand occupations, any business that
meets the requirements is encouraged to participate. Employer eligibility
criteria includes:
An established, verified, paid-to-date UI account
A valid business license, if required
Must enter into a contract which establishes the following:
•Wage
•# of hours to master primary tasks
•Maximum amount of reimbursement (up to 50% of the initially agreed upon
wage; maximum 40 hours/week; does not include overtime, holiday, sick, or
vacation time)
•Contract length (based on estimate of time needed to complete training)
•Method for reimbursement – timesheet/invoice and progress report

Silver State Works Incentive Programs
Incentive Based Employment – Supports employers who hire and
retain eligible workers in full-time employment (30 hours or more)
Reimburses a portion of the wages in order to offset costs of training
and employee development
Upon completion of certain requirements, the employer may receive a
wage retention supplement of, on average, up to $2,000 payable in
increments after each 30 days of successful employment; not to exceed
120 days
In some instances the incentive could be higher depending upon job
readiness levels and the amount of resources required to train the
participant
Employer Agreement outlines the following:
•Role and responsibility to employee
•Hourly wage rate (NV minimum wage or wage for similar job)
•Employer provides sick and holiday pay similar to other employees
